Help! My Russian Tortoise...

[ Login ] [ User Prefs ] [ Search Forums ] [ Back to Main Page ] [ Back to Turtles - General ] [ Reply To This Message ]
[ Register to Post ]

Posted by: tess10210 at Tue Nov 6 22:49:20 2007  [ Report Abuse ] [ Email Message ] [ Show All Posts by tess10210 ]  
   

I have a russian tortoise that I got about a month ago. I am concerned because she doesn't eat or poop very much... she eats very little and i've only seen her poop maybe 2 times. Could it just be that she is not adjusted to her new home yet? Her box is fairly large and has a lot of reptile bark for burrowing and a heat lamp and water for soaking, and i feed her yams, lettuce, snow peas, etc, and occasionally also feed her fruit. I spray her twice a day and soak her in warm water about once a week to avoid dehydration. I take her outside every couple of days (I live in the seattle area - not very nice weather in the fall...) where she seems to enjoy running around and occasionally eating grass and such.



Any thoughts on her habits and how to make her happier would be welcome!
